Ways to Use Leftovers
- Whole Chicken – There are many dishes to make with this shredded chicken. Our favorites include Chicken Quesadilla Recipe and Oven Nachos.
- Tuna Salad – With my leftovers, I like to make Tuna Salad Sandwich Recipe for a quick lunch the next day.
- Salmon – Shred the salmon and make Fish Tacos Recipe for a delicious recipe that everyone will love.
- Chicken and Vegetables – I love to chop up the leftovers and make Easy Chicken Fried Rice Recipe.
